Barrhaven gets new exit, otherwise little new for Ottawa in Ontario budget
The province is funding a new Barrhaven interchange along Highway 416 to meet the needs of booming subdivisions in the area — one of the few capital projects in Ottawa listed in this year's Ontario budget.
